Chances are, the first real decision anybody makes is figuring out what they'll use the garage for after the conversion - without that, everything else is just guesswork. When push comes to shove, most go for a setup that gives them a quiet work zone, an extra pair of bedsheets, a place to keep fit, or a lounge that doesn't feel miles away from the action. You get a lot of creative freedom with a garage conversion - it's all up to your imagination, apart from the occasional nudge from the building inspector.

The fact you can often avoid applying for full planning permission is a bit of a win in itself. If the main part is already built, it often falls under permitted development rules, so you can skip the long planning process and all the hassle with paperwork. Just to be on the safe side, have a chat with your local council - it's better than guessing and getting it wrong.

Best to deal with the insulation and heating setup before any doors come off or new walls start going up. Garages weren't built with comfort in mind, so it's pretty likely you will need to beef up the walls, floor, and ceiling if you want it to be cosy in winter and not unbearable in summer. That cold, drafty garage will not know what hit it once you've got some warmth coming through the floor or a couple of solid radiators humming away in the corners.

If you're turning that empty garage into a nice living area, don't forget about the insulation up top - it's the main thing that keeps things warm in winter and cool in summer. Since garages weren't really built with human comfort in mind, it's no surprise that without that insulation overhead, the space can get unbearably chilly or boiling hot. No matter if your roof is flat or sloped, spending a bit extra on decent materials can really pay off by stopping heat from leaking out and saving you money on energy bills.

One thing many people overlook is that the floor in the extension might sit a little lower than the main house, so it's good to factor that in. It's not just about making it comfy - lifting the floor can help prevent trips too. Get that detail right, and suddenly the whole place feels less like a converted garden shed and more like somewhere you'd actually live.

Whether it's for guests, a home office, or just extra room, good floor insulation is the bit that turns a converted garage from chilly shell to welcoming space. Most garage floors are just cold slabs of concrete. If you're planning to raise the level or lay down a floating floor, adding rigid insulation or something similar will help keep the chill away. Do yourself a favour and get it sorted early - you will feel the difference when the temperature drops and the bills don't shoot up.

A bit of daylight goes a long way. Most garages were never meant to be lived in, which shows in how dark they are - so adding windows or French doors is a solid move if you're changing that. When natural light just isn't going to happen, don't be shy with artificial options - combine spots, wall lights and standing lamps for a warmer, cosier feel.

Use your head when mapping things out - because in a garage conversion, poor layout choices can turn potential into wasted space in no time. A little peace goes a long way, so if you're setting it up as a guest nook or desk space, make sure the walls can handle the roar from the street outside. It's not just about having a light switch and one socket near the door - think ahead to what you will actually use the space for and build in the electrics accordingly from the get-go.

How fancy you want to go will affect things - and if you're adding a bathroom or sink, you'll need to think about plumbing early on. Even a modest little kitchenette or a wet wiping spot screams for real plumbing - meaning if you're heading in that direction, it's better to plan for it now than regret it later. It'll add to the bill slightly, but the last thing you will want is to leave your cosy new room just to make a cup of tea.

If you're thinking about value for money, then converting a garage tends to be a much cheaper alternative than going down the extension route. Not having to build new walls or a roof makes a big difference when it comes to the total cost. The final bill will be shaped by your choices, yet even luxury finishes tend to be more cost-effective than a complete rebuild. And since you're not building from scratch, things usually come together a lot quicker, which can shave a good chunk off both the labour time and the upheaval.

Smart Ugrade Possibilities

Turning your garage into a proper living space? Now's the time to think about some upgrades. Data cabling for faster internet, Wi-Fi boosters to keep your signal steady, and a handful of home automation gadgets can make your life a lot easier. Whether it's smart lighting, app-controlled heating or just having enough ethernet points for a slick home office setup, getting the tech side sorted early can save a lot of faffing about later on. Sorting cables is a breeze when things are open - but once the plasterboard's gone up and the floor's done, you're asking for hassle.

What About DIY?

The do-it-yourself crowd often like to jump in and handle some parts of the work themselves - especially if they've done similar before. Painting and basic joinery are within your reach, but anything involving the building's structure or electrics should be handled by a professional. A botched job could cost you a lot more to fix, and don't forget that safety regulations must be observed when handling specialist jobs.

The Exterior Finish

One bit that doesn't always get the attention it should is how the outside of the garage looks once it's been converted. That section where the garage door used to be needs careful attention - get the look wrong and it'll stick out straight away. A seamless look can make your home appear more cohesive and appealing, plus it could come in handy if you decide to sell eventually. Estate agents usually notice when something feels off balance, even if they don't point it out directly. Matching the exterior helps the garage conversion feel like a natural part of your home, rather than an obvious extension.

Converting a Garage Into a Granny Annexe

Turning your old garage into a separate living space for a grandparent is a neat solution - gives them room to breathe but keeps them close enough to check in on easily. You'll want to factor in some practical upgrades - heating, plumbing, proper insulation, and possibly a kitchenette to make the space work on its own. If you take the time to plan and get the design just right, that old garage can be transformed into a warm, comfortable retreat, feeling as much part of the house as anything else.
